Your request will be processed within 7 to 10 business days mail delivery time will depend on the postal service. There is no postage or handling fee for electronically transmitted documents. There will also be at least a $7.00 postage and handling fee applied if mailing the requested documents. Depending on the research required to fulfill your request, research fees may be applied. Please contact the agency you are providing the copy to in order to determine if they require a certified copy. If you are using the copy for legal or official purposes, a certified copy may be required. In addition, there is a $30.00 charge to certify any document. To make payment by credit card, call (602) 37-CLERK, or (602) 372-5375.Ĭopy fees are $0.50 per page. The Clerk's Office accepts payment in the form of a money order made payable to the Clerk of the Court with the name, address, and phone # of the customer on the front, or by debit card or credit card (MasterCard, Visa or American Express). Once the appropriate fees have been assessed, you will be sent via mail, or e-mail if provided, a fee statement specific to your request. Please indicate whether you require just the divorce decree or if you require the property settlement or custody agreement as well, and whether or not this is for a name change with the Social Security Administration.

There is no postage or handling fee for electronically transmitted documents.The money order must include the customer name, address, and phone # of the customer on the front. For certified copies of marriage licenses in paper format with a raised seal, include a money order payable to the Clerk of the Court for $30.50, along with a business-size, self-addressed stamped envelope (or a money order for $37.50 for postage and handling instead of a business-size, self-addressed stamped envelope).Please indicate whether or not this is for a name change with the Social Security Administration.

#Maricopa county court records full

  • The full legal names of both applicants prior to the marriage the year the marriage took place the marriage license number shown at the bottom of the marriage license certificate, if known.
  • You may obtain a copy or certified copy of a marriage license at a Clerk's Office location.
